View all →Synopsis
Zbigniew Ziembinski fled Poland just before the invasion of Warsaw, eventually becoming a significant figure in Brazilian theater. The documentary features a polyphonic montage that includes unpublished materials, performances, and interviews spanning over fifty years. It presents a recreation of scenes from 'Wedding Dress,' a play by Nelson Rodrigues that Ziembinski transformed in 1943. Through this collection, the film reflects on Ziembinski's lasting impact on modern theater in Latin America.
